Career path

Career Role (Climate Change Mitigation in Semiconductor Manufacturing) Description
Sustainability Engineer (Semiconductor, Green Tech) Develops and implements strategies to reduce the environmental footprint of semiconductor manufacturing processes, focusing on energy efficiency and waste reduction. High demand, excellent career progression.
Process Optimization Specialist (Energy Efficiency, Semiconductor) Optimizes manufacturing processes to minimize energy consumption and waste generation, improving both profitability and environmental sustainability within semiconductor fabs. Strong analytical skills needed.
Environmental Compliance Manager (Semiconductor, Regulatory Affairs) Ensures the semiconductor facility complies with all relevant environmental regulations and permits, minimizing environmental risks and liabilities. Knowledge of UK environmental law is essential.
Green Supply Chain Manager (Sustainable Semiconductor Manufacturing) Manages the environmental impact of the semiconductor supply chain, sourcing sustainable materials and reducing carbon emissions across the entire value chain. Growing field with significant potential.
Renewable Energy Specialist (Semiconductor, Solar/Wind) Integrates renewable energy sources into semiconductor manufacturing facilities, reducing reliance on fossil fuels and lowering carbon emissions. Expertise in renewable energy technologies is vital.
